What is PEP and How Does It Work?
PEP (Post-Exposure Prophylaxis) is an emergency medical treatment designed to prevent HIV infection after a single potential exposure. Unlike PrEP (Pre-Exposure Prophylaxis), which is taken regularly before potential exposure, PEP is an intensive, 28-day antiretroviral medication course prescribed after high-risk contact has occurred.
The Critical 72-Hour Window
When it comes to PEP, time is of the essence.
-
Best Results: Ideally started within 2 to 24 hours after exposure.
-
Maximum Limit: Must be initiated no later than 72 hours (3 days) post-exposure.
Once the virus enters the body, it requires time to replicate and establish a permanent infection. Starting PEP medication Singapore early allows antiretroviral drugs to stop the virus from multiplying, giving your immune system the upper hand to clear it. If you delay beyond 72 hours, the effectiveness of PEP drops significantly, making immediate consultation critical.
When Should You Consider PEP?
You should seek immediate evaluation at a clinic if you have experienced any of the following within the past 72 hours:
-
Unprotected vaginal or anal intercourse with a partner whose HIV status is positive or unknown.
-
A condom breakage, tear, or slippage during sex.
-
Exposure during commercial sex or casual sexual encounters where protection was compromised.
-
Non-occupational accidents, such as sharing needles or accidental needle-stick injuries.
-
Instances of sexual assault.

Overcoming Stigma: The Importance of Anonymous & Confidential Testing
One of the largest hurdles preventing individuals from seeking sexual health care is the fear of judgment, lack of privacy, or social stigma. Fortunately, healthcare protocols in Singapore prioritize patient discretion.
How Anonymous HIV Testing Works
For individuals seeking peace of mind without linked personal records, select licensed medical institutions offer designated anonymous testing services.
-
No NRIC/Passport Recording: You are not required to provide personal identification details like your name or NRIC.
-
Discreet Identifier: Your test sample and records are managed using a unique reference code, ensuring total anonymity.
-
Rapid Results: Many rapid screening tests deliver preliminary results in as little as 15 to 20 minutes during your visit.

Comprehensive Screening: Why Testing for Other STIs Matters
While HIV prevention is often a top concern, many sexually transmitted infections (STIs)—including Chlamydia, Gonorrhea, Syphilis, and Herpes—can present silently without noticeable symptoms. Left untreated, hidden STIs can cause long-term reproductive health complications or increase susceptibility to other infections.

What to Expect During Your Visit
If you suspect you need PEP or want to undergo routine screening, knowing what happens during a clinical visit can help relieve anxiety:
-
Confidential Consultation: A doctor conducts a private assessment of your medical history and the specific exposure incident.
-
Baseline Testing: Rapid screening is performed to confirm baseline status before initiating PEP medication or standard treatment.
-
Immediate Medication Dispensing: If indicated, your 28-day PEP course is prescribed and provided on the spot so you can take your first dose without delay.
-
Follow-Up Plan: A scheduled follow-up outline (typically at 1 month and 3 months) ensures ongoing health monitoring and post-treatment confirmation.
